Next up is installing my iPad. First the iPad and dash were tapped off and layered up with fiberglass mat, trimmed to size then the two were attached together using Marglass. A bracket with two 1/4"-20 bolts was glassed to the back of the iPad mount.











 
Incredible build. How are you sealed the pods to the enclosure within the a-pillar/fender?
I used a strip of rubber/foam that is used for home door jams. Hopefully it will seal along with the 7 bolts with fender washers that are being used to secure the pod to the body/A-piller.
